For dancers, performances are their biggest events – a showcase of artistry. Over the last two years, dance schools across the world have struggled to make it to the stage due to the pandemic. On November 15, 2021 at 5:30 p.m. at the Forum Events Center, En Pointe Indiana Ballet is excited to return to a bit of normalcy and share that artistry with the Fishers community for the very first time in a Mixed Repertory Showcase thanks to a $2500 performing arts grant from the Fishers Arts & Culture Commission.
Two En Pointe teachers and professional Dance Kaleidoscope dancers, Emily Franks and Paige Robinson, applied for and received the grant after hearing about it within an Indy Arts Council e-newsletter. The Mixed Repertory Showcase will feature pieces from En Pointe Artistic Directors Robert Moore and Pollyana Ribeiro, along with pieces from colleague and guest artist Weston Krukow, pieces from Franks and Robinson, and David Hochoy’s, Artistic Director of Dance Kaleidoscope, celebrated Skin Walkers, a dynamic, mystical Celtic feel-good piece about a group of shape shifters.
“This is what we love to do and to be able to make a performance opportunity happen for the kids we teach is so special,” said Robinson. “As a staff, we had been talking about increasing our modern dance offerings and this is a perfect opportunity to showcase our modern and contemporary repertoire for the community.”
“All dancers need to be well-rounded and diverse, especially those seeking professional careers,” said Co-Artistic Director Robert Moore. “We are extremely proud of Paige and Emily, as they spearhead this showcase and help expose our students to such diverse chorographers and forms of dance. Additionally, we are thankful to have had the opportunity to work in collaboration with our talented colleagues.”
“This is a full circle moment for me,” said Franks. “I’m getting to teach my students a piece I learned while at the University of Oklahoma in 2018, when David Hochoy was a guest choreographer. I can’t wait for the audience to enjoy this dynamic performance and see our students’ artistry on display.”
